Asbestos Consultant Location:

Stevenage, Hertfordshire Salary/Benefits:

£25k - £42k + Training & Benefits Our Client is a professional Asbestos outfit, with a national presence and a growing presence. You will have experience undertaking the full range of Asbestos Surveys and Analytical duties, as well as providing a thorough consultancy service to Clients, advising on identified risks and updates on projects. Applicants with an organised and hardworking manner would suit this role as days vary and you will be required to manage your time well. Access to the M1 and/or M25 would be beneficial. Experience / Qualifications: You must have experience working as an Asbestos Surveyor / Analyst Will hold the BOHS P402, P403 & P404 (or RSPH equivalent) Able to effectively communicate with Clients when providing project updates and technical advice Can demonstrate a high level of industry knowledge Comfortable working across a range of IT software and applications Strong written ability The Role: Undertaking Management, Refurbishment and Demolition Asbestos Surveys across a mixed portfolio of Commercial, Industrial and Public Sector sites Conducting 4 Stage Clearances as well as personal, leak, background and reassurance air testing Completing safe sampling of suspected ACMs Writing detailed technical reports Completing auditing on other surveyors and analysts Ensuring compliance is maintained across projects Alternative job titles:
